Candle Safety

Place candle in an upright position on a secure, heat resistant surface.

Never leave a burning flame unattended.

Keep candle away from flammable materials, sources of heat, overhanging objects and polished surfaces.


Do not move candles when lit or if the wax is still liquid.

We advise not burning the final 1cm of wax as this could result in the container becoming very hot. However, if you do so, please use additional heat protection beneath the candle.

If the flame exceeds 2cm in height or begins to soot, extinguish the candle, allow to cool and solidify, then trim the wick and relight.


Always trim wick to 5mm prior to lighting. Burn for 4 hours maximum at a time. Keep the wax pool clear of matches and other debris to avoid flaring. Snuff out flame. Do not blow out.
